Following breakfast, you’ll be greeted by our safari guide, who will be your companion for the next few days. Drive to Lake Manyara National Park for a few hours of captivating game viewing, pausing for a light picnic lunch. This park offers a wilderness experience across diverse habitats, from its Rift Valley soda lake to dense woodlands and steep mountainsides.
The shores of the lake, adorned with pink flamingos, attract over 400 bird species depending on the season. Besides the formidable predators, you may encounter buffalo herds, Masai giraffes, and impalas along the lake shores and forested valley slopes. Today calls for an early start as you descend into the Ngorongoro Crater, granting you a couple of hours for exceptional game viewing before the crowds arrive. The Ngorongoro Crater, often referred to as Africa’s “eighth wonder of the world” and “Africa’s Eden,” is a stunning natural wonder. Formed 2.5 million years ago after an extinct volcano collapsed upon itself, this caldera is the largest of its kind globally. Here, you’ll have the best opportunity to spot the Big Five and indulge in a packed picnic-style lunch before returning to camp.
